**feat(models): add pre-bundled Universal Sentence Encoder for offline use**

- Introduced `@soulcraft/brainy-models` package with pre-bundled TensorFlow models for enhanced offline reliability.
- Added `index.d.ts` and `index.js` allowing offline embedding workflows with the Universal Sentence Encoder model.
- Included utility scripts for model compression, size retrieval, and availability checks.
- Added `metadata.json` and `model.json` defining the Universal Sentence Encoder configuration with offline bundling.
- Ensured comprehensive model documentation, error handling, and robust logging for seamless integration.
- Supported optional model quantization placeholders for future TensorFlow.js enhancements.

**Purpose**: Enable fully offline-ready embedding workflows via pre-bundled Universal Sentence Encoder models, ensuring maximum reliability and air-gapped environment compatibility.
